This book has been specifically developed for the new Standard Grade Chemistry syllabus. Building on the authors' teaching experience, the book addresses the real needs of teachers and students and provides a complete, coherent course for all students tackling this course and examination. The text is organized in short, structured topics, each covering a double-page spread. Each spread includes a number of short questions to help students put into action the concepts and skills covered by the topic. Credit level material has been highlighted, thus allowing differentiation within the framework of the book, and each unit is complemented by a range of carefully graded activities suitable for learning, consolidation and revision.
